mysql数据库太大 mysql数据量越来越大

导读:
MySQL是一款开源的关系型数据库管理系统,随着数据量的不断增加,如何优化MySQL的性能成为了每个DBA必须面对的问题 。本文将从多个方面介绍如何应对MySQL数据量越来越大的情况 。
1. 索引优化
索引是MySQL优化中最重要的一环,索引可以加快查询速度,减少磁盘IO次数 。在数据量大的情况下,需要定期检查并优化索引,避免因过多或无用的索引导致查询变慢 。
2. 分区表
当数据量达到一定程度时,可以考虑使用分区表技术,将数据按照某种规则划分到不同的物理表中,减少单表数据量的压力,提高查询效率 。
3. 数据库分库分表
如果单机MySQL已经无法满足业务需求,可以考虑将数据进行分库分表 。分库分表可以将数据分散到多个MySQL实例中,减轻单机MySQL的负担,提高整体性能 。
4. 定期备份与恢复
随着数据量的增加 , 数据库备份和恢复也变得更加重要 。定期备份可以保证数据安全,同时也可以防止数据恢复时造成的性能影响 。
5. 数据库参数优化
MySQL的性能不仅与硬件有关,还与数据库的参数设置有关 。在数据量大的情况下,需要根据实际情况调整MySQL的参数,以达到最佳性能 。
总结:
【mysql数据库太大 mysql数据量越来越大】随着数据量的不断增加,MySQL的优化变得越来越重要 。通过索引优化、分区表、数据库分库分表、定期备份与恢复以及数据库参数优化等多种手段,可以有效提高MySQL的性能,满足业务需求 。

    推荐阅读